I have the AT F7 and it is a nice cartridge for the price. It has a fairly narrow profile for an elliptical stylus. I would not classify AT cartridges as warm but accurate. I have the Benz MC Gold but I prefer the AT F7.

I use a Nagaoka MP-200. It leans on the warmer side, is dynamic and is somewhat forgiving on surface noise. I bought mine direct from Japan for $150 off the U.S. price. It arrived in 3 days.
